零基础娃娃也能轻松入门Python编程:趣味游戏与简单代码280
大家好,我是你们的编程小助手!今天咱们要聊一个超有趣的话题——娃娃学编程Python!很多家长都觉得编程离孩子们很遥远,其实不然!Python这门语言以其简洁易懂的语法,成为了孩子学习编程的绝佳入门选择。别被“编程”两个字吓到,我们不会一下子就跳进复杂的代码海洋,而是从最基础、最有趣的方面入手,让孩子们在玩乐中轻松掌握Python的奥秘。
那么,为什么选择Python作为孩子的编程启蒙语言呢?原因很简单:它足够“友好”。不像其他编程语言那样充满各种让人头大的符号和复杂的语法规则,Python的代码更像日常英语,易于理解和记忆。 想象一下,用Python写一个简单的游戏,然后自己玩,那种成就感是无法比拟的!这远比死记硬背语法规则更能激发孩子的学习兴趣。
我们先从最基本的Python概念开始。Python程序的核心是指令,也就是告诉电脑做什么。这些指令由代码组成,代码是由英文单词和特殊符号组成的语句。别担心,我们不会一开始就用一堆专业术语来“吓唬”孩子们。我们会用通俗易懂的语言,结合生动的例子,让孩子们理解这些概念。
1. 打印输出(print):这是Python中最简单的指令之一,它可以将文字或数字显示在屏幕上。例如,print("你好,世界!") 这行代码就会在屏幕上打印出“你好,世界!”。是不是很简单?我们可以引导孩子尝试打印自己的名字、年龄、喜欢的颜色等等,让孩子体会到代码的乐趣。
2. 变量:变量就像一个可以存放东西的盒子。我们可以把数字、文字或者其他数据存储在变量中,方便以后使用。例如,name = "小明" 这行代码就把“小明”这个名字存储在名为name的变量中。 我们可以用各种形象的比喻,比如“宝箱”、“储物柜”来帮助孩子理解变量的概念。
3. 数据类型:Python中有很多种数据类型,例如数字(整数、小数)、文字(字符串)、布尔值(真或假)等等。我们可以通过一些简单的例子,例如计算年龄、比较身高等等,让孩子们自然地接触到不同的数据类型。
4. 条件语句(if…else):这是用来控制程序流程的。例如,我们可以写一个程序,如果天气好,就打印“去公园玩!”;如果天气不好,就打印“在家看书!”。这需要用到if和else语句。我们可以用游戏的方式,例如设计一个简单的猜数字游戏,来帮助孩子理解条件语句的用法。
5. 循环语句(for…in):循环语句可以重复执行一段代码。例如,我们可以用循环语句打印1到10的所有数字。这在游戏中非常有用,例如让游戏角色重复移动等等。我们可以用画图的方式,让孩子理解循环的含义,例如画一个正方形,需要重复四次画线。
学习编程不仅仅是学习语法,更重要的是培养孩子的逻辑思维能力和解决问题的能力。在学习Python的过程中,我们可以引导孩子们进行一些简单的项目实践,例如:
• 设计一个简单的猜数字游戏:让电脑随机生成一个数字,让孩子猜,并给出提示(大了或小了)。
• 制作一个简单的计算器:可以进行加减乘除运算。
• 设计一个简单的文本冒险游戏:让孩子根据自己的想法设计游戏剧情和分支。
记住,学习编程是一个循序渐进的过程,不必急于求成。鼓励孩子多练习,多尝试,从简单的程序开始,逐步提高难度。 家长可以和孩子一起学习,一起完成项目,这不仅可以增进亲子关系,还能让孩子更有动力去学习。
最后,我想说的是,学习编程的目的不是为了成为程序员,而是为了培养孩子的计算思维、逻辑思维和解决问题的能力。 Python是一个很好的入门语言,它可以让孩子们在玩乐中学习,在学习中成长。希望这篇文章能帮助更多娃娃们开启他们的编程之旅!
2025-03-21

Python启蒙:零基础免费学习指南
https://jb123.cn/python/50112.html

制作脚本的最佳编程软件推荐及选择指南
https://jb123.cn/jiaobenbiancheng/50111.html

Shell脚本编程:数字自增的妙招与技巧
https://jb123.cn/jiaobenbiancheng/50110.html

C#脚本语言在游戏开发中的应用详解
https://jb123.cn/jiaobenyuyan/50109.html

GOT触摸屏脚本编程详解:从入门到实战
https://jb123.cn/jiaobenbiancheng/50108.html
热门文章

Python 编程解密:从谜团到清晰
https://jb123.cn/python/24279.html

Python编程深圳:初学者入门指南
https://jb123.cn/python/24225.html

Python 编程终端:让开发者畅所欲为的指令中心
https://jb123.cn/python/22225.html

Python 编程专业指南:踏上编程之路的全面指南
https://jb123.cn/python/20671.html

Python 面向对象编程学习宝典,PDF 免费下载
https://jb123.cn/python/3929.html